Protein Preparation and Western Blot Analysis

Check if the same lab product or an alternative is used in the 5 most similar protocols
The cellular proteins were prepared from cells growing on a 6-well plate after treatments of BNAG1, or BNAG2 or NAG using a commercial RIPA buffer (5X) (Catalog No. AAJ62524AD, Thermo Fisher Scientific) containing a protease inhibitor cocktail (Catalog No. sc-29130, Santa Cruz Biotechnology Inc., Dallas, TX, USA) and 1 mM phenylmethylsulfonyl fluoride (Catalog No. sc-482875, Santa Cruz Biotechnology Inc.). Then the protein concentration was determined using the Bradford protein assay kit (Catalog No. 5000201, Bio-Rad, Hercules, CA, USA). SDS-polyacrylamide gel electrophoresis, protein transfer to nitrocellulose membranes (Catalog No. 88025, Thermo Fisher Scientific), incubation of membranes with primary antibodies against mouse iNOS and Cox-2 (Catalog No. NB300-605 and NB110-1948, both from Novus Biologicals, LLC), and horseradish peroxidase (HRP)-conjugated secondary antibody (Catalog No. 7074S, Cell Signaling), and visualization of protein bands were performed according to the procedures described previously [18 (link)]. β-actin (Catalog No. sc-47778, Santa Cruz Biotechnology Inc.) was used as the loading control. All Western blot assays were conducted in duplicates.

Quantitative Immunoblotting of Lens Proteins

Check if the same lab product or an alternative is used in the 5 most similar protocols
Lenses at stage P15 from Tdrd7−/− and control mice were subjected to RIPA lysis buffer to prepare lens lysate. Protein lysate concentration was determined by BCA assay following the manufacturer’s instructions (Pierce BCA Protein Assay Kit, Thermo Fisher Scientific). Equal concentrations of the protein lysate for Tdrd7−/− and control lenses were loaded on a 7% polyacrylamide gel and then transferred onto PVDF membrane. The membrane was blocked with 5% milk in Tris-buffered saline with 0.1% Tween 20 (TBST) for 1 h at room temperature, followed by overnight incubation at 4°C with primary antibody for HSPB1 (Abcam, Catalog No. ab2790, used at 1:200 diln.) and for beta-actin (loading control) (Abcam, Catalog No. ab8227) in the blocking buffer. The membrane was then washed and probed with a secondary HRP-conjugated antibody (Cell Signaling, Catalog No. 7074S) for 1 h at room temperature, followed by washes and imaging.
